Summary
Stroke commonly results in persistent upper limb impairment that limits functional independence and participation in daily activities. Modified Constraint-Induced Movement Therapy (mCIMT) is an evidence-based intervention for improving upper limb function after stroke. Tele-rehabilitation has emerged as an alternative method of delivering rehabilitation services, potentially improving accessibility while maintaining treatment effectiveness. This randomized controlled trial will compare the effectiveness of tele-rehabilitation-based mCIMT with clinic-based mCIMT in individuals with chronic stroke. Sixty-eight eligible participants will be randomly allocated into two groups. The tele-rehabilitation group will receive supervised mCIMT through virtual sessions combined with a structured home exercise program, while the clinic-based group will receive the same intervention in a clinical setting. Both groups will receive treatment three times per week for 6 weeks. Upper limb function, spasticity, motor performance, and intrinsic motivation will be assessed at baseline and after the 6-week intervention using the Upper Extremity Fugl-Meyer Assessment (UEFMA), Modified Ashworth Scale (MAS), Wolf Motor Function Test (WMFT), and Intrinsic Motivation Inventory (IMI). The study aims to determine whether tele-rehabilitation is as effective as clinic-based mCIMT for improving upper limb function in individuals with chronic stroke.
